The global Zonal Heat Pump Cabin HVAC Market is entering a decade of strong structural growth, driven by deep integration of energy-efficient thermal management technologies into electrified vehicle platforms and specialty equipment. Valued at USD 2,466.2 million in 2026, the market is projected to reach USD 7,728.3 million by 2036, expanding at a robust CAGR of 12.1% during the forecast period. Growth is being shaped not by discretionary upgrades, but by platform-level engineering decisions that prioritize efficiency, range optimization, and localized occupant comfort.

Market Outlook: Engineering-Led Growth Momentum
Unlike traditional HVAC markets influenced by aftermarket replacement cycles, demand for zonal heat pump cabin HVAC systems is primarily concentrated in OEM line-fit installations. Automakers, rail manufacturers, and off-highway equipment producers are embedding these systems early in vehicle development to manage battery load, utilize waste heat, and support multi-zone comfort delivery. As zonal architectures replace single-zone layouts and heat pumps substitute resistive heating, the content value per vehicle continues to rise, strengthening revenue formation across the supply chain.
Why Demand Is Accelerating Across Mobility Platforms
The growing adoption of electric passenger vehicles, rail cabins, construction machinery, and agricultural equipment is directly boosting demand for zonal heat pump HVAC solutions. These systems deliver precise thermal control to occupied zones, improving operator comfort while minimizing energy consumption. Regulatory emphasis on occupational health, efficiency benchmarks, and emissions reduction further reinforces specification of advanced HVAC architectures.
Electrification programs worldwide are accelerating the shift toward integrated HVAC modules that combine compressors, valves, heat exchangers, sensors, and advanced controls. Procurement teams increasingly favor suppliers that can deliver compact, validated systems capable of seamless integration with vehicle electrical and thermal management architectures.

Key Segments of the Zonal Heat Pump Cabin HVAC Market
By Zonal Layout
- 2-Zone: Holds the largest share (34.0%), balancing comfort differentiation with system simplicity
- 3-Zone: Supports enhanced customization in mid-to-premium platforms
- 4+ Zone: Enables advanced comfort control for luxury and specialty applications
- Other: Niche configurations for unique cabin designs
By Heat Pump Type
- Integrated Reversible Heat Pump: Dominates with 54.0% share due to combined heating and cooling capability
- Ejector or Enhanced Heat Pump: Improves efficiency under specific operating conditions
- CO₂ Heat Pump: Supports compliance with refrigerant regulations
- Other: Specialized architectures for targeted performance needs
By Vehicle Segment
- Passenger EVs: Account for 60.0% of demand, driven by volume and range sensitivity
- Luxury EVs: Adopt higher zoning complexity for premium comfort
- LCV EVs: Apply zonal HVAC based on duty cycle efficiency
- Other: Rail, off-highway, and specialty mobility platforms

Regional Growth Highlights
Global expansion is led by Asia Pacific, Europe, and North America, supported by electrification policies and efficiency regulations.
- China (CAGR 14.1%) benefits from massive EV production volumes, electric bus deployment, and a strong domestic HVAC supply base.
- Brazil (CAGR 13.9%) sees rising adoption driven by high ambient temperatures and electric urban transit programs.
- USA (CAGR 11.5%) focuses on platform redesign, fleet efficiency, and software-controlled zonal climate systems.
- South Korea (CAGR 11.3%) leverages advanced EV engineering and export-oriented compliance needs.
- Germany (CAGR 11.2%) emphasizes premium comfort, energy efficiency, and next-generation vehicle integration.
Competitive Landscape: Established Leaders and Emerging Innovators
The competitive environment reflects a blend of established global Tier-1 suppliers and new manufacturers investing in advanced thermal technologies to expand their footprint. Market leaders such as Valeo, Denso, Hanon Systems, MAHLE, Sanden, Bosch, Marelli, Eberspächer, Modine, and Gentherm continue to strengthen their positions through integrated heat pump platforms, high-efficiency compressors, and sophisticated control software.
At the same time, emerging suppliers and technology developers are forming new partnerships, focusing on modular designs, refrigerant-compliant systems, and software-driven zoning algorithms. These innovations are enabling faster validation cycles, improved packaging flexibility, and scalable deployment across multiple vehicle programs.
